Skip to main content

Community Support Team

128 Liverpool Road, Aughton, Ormskirk, Lancashire, L39 3LW

Contact details and opening times

Facilities

No information available

Last confirmed: 6 June 2017


Information supplied by Lancashire & South Cumbria NHS Foundation Trust